21.01.2022 Champ the Wonderdog!! Champ is a 7 year old Border Collie, and one of our amazing team of canine volunteers here on the POP! program; helping preschoolers overcome their phobia of dogs. Coming from a long line of working (herding) stock, Champ's destiny seemed marked from birth. However, at the age of 4, he was deemed unsuitable and returned to the breeder. Fortunately, he was re-homed with owner Sally, and for the past couple of years the two have been generously giving thei...r time volunteering with local community programs. A couple of fun facts about Champ: his favourite food is quail and his best party trick is spinning on the spot Sally says 3 words that sum up Champ are: empathetic, hard-working, and loyal. Thank you Sally and Champ for your wonderful contribution to this important research work!! Preschoolers Overcoming Phobias (POP!) is an Australian Government (NHMRC) funded research program offering free assessments and treatment for children aged 3-5 with a specific phobia. 13.01.2022 The OCD Busters research team at the School of Applied Psychology, Griffith University want to know what impact COVID-19 might be having on OCD symptoms in youn...g people. We are inviting parents and/or caregivers of a child aged 5 - 17 years to complete a short, confidential research survey (20-30 minutes). The survey will ask several questions regarding your household's experiences over the past few months whilst navigating this period of confusion and upheaval. The survey will also ask questions about what you and your child may have been thinking, feeling or doing during this time. While we are interested in OCD/OCD symptoms specifically, your child does not need to have OCD or any mental health condition to participate. 09.01.2022 Do you have a child aged 3 to 5 who experiences a specific phobia? (e.g., intense fear of dogs, spiders, darkness, heights, doctors/dentists, costume characters...) Griffith University CAN help, with a FREE assessment and treatment through their POP! (Preschoolers Overcoming Phoboias) Program. The POP! program is an Australian Government National Health and Medical Research Council (NHMRC) funded study led by Associate Professor Lara Farrell and a team of internationally renowned experts specialising in research of evidence-based interventions for the treatment of anxiety-related disorders in children and adolescents.
